What is an International Driver Permit (IDP)?
An International Driver Permit is a file that enables motorists to legally drive a lorry in foreign nations. It functions as a translation of your domestic driver's license and is acknowledged in numerous countries worldwide, consisting of Poland. Getting an International Driver Permit is reasonably basic.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Steps to Obtain an IDPDescription1. Inspect EligibilityEnsure you hold a legitimate driver's license in your home country.2. Choose an IssuerThe IDP can be gotten from authorized companies, such as the American Automobile Association (AAA) in the US, or the Automobile Association in your nation.3. Gather Necessary DocumentsNormally, you will need your original driver's license, a passport-sized photo, and a finished application.4.
